Output 959b4fa3d06615bb1458359f92689ebb0b2333308d45d96f5540b9a3f27ed2af:7

value
59215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f15457f80175330af4300877418c8e28c0a2dd4f OP_EQUAL
address
3Ph3p5BUptznbq7kR1jGCLPskR816N5kpM
transaction
959b4fa3d06615bb1458359f92689ebb0b2333308d45d96f5540b9a3f27ed2af
spent
true